Its for sure ~1ft from the walls and a ~2ft gap between each board. Over lapping starts at ~12" and good uniformity you'll get from ~18" and above. And between each row of two boards there is a gap of ~1ft. Goal is always to get even distribution(80% uniformity) with the lowest possible distance.

Going of the HLG site if i'm using 480h c2100 for 4 96s.... each 96s be running at what watts?
I would use the HLG-480H-54A or B version it offers much more flexibility.
With parallel wiring you can add more boards easily to make your light more efficient. With series wiring you are forced to use 4 boards and to increase efficiency you would need at least another 4 boards for a 2nd parallel string.
Parallel is also more fail safe. If one board fails the remainig 3 would still work; with a series circuit the whole light would go off.
And last but not least, you get more watts from a CV / CC driver.

Samsung unveils horticulture LED products for greenhouse, vertical farming
Industry 08:52 November 21, 2018
SEOUL, Nov. 21 (Yonhap) -- Samsung Electronics Co. on Wednesday showcased a new lineup of horticulture light-emitting diode (LED) solutions optimized for greenhouses and vertical farming, which can help farmers improve produce quality.
The South Korean tech giant said the new products, including white full-spectrum packages and modules, as well as color LEDs, provide farmers with a broader spectrum of light that leads to healthier plant growth, along with reduced lighting system costs.
"Samsung's full-spectrum-based horticulture LEDs present a new way of using LED lighting to improve plant cultivation at reduced system costs," Samsung Electronics said. "We plan to further expand our horticulture offerings by integrating the latest in smart LED lighting technology, including Samsung's leading sensor and connectivity solutions."
Compared with narrow spectrum lighting, Samsung said the full-spectrum-based LEDs can help plants grow healthier by "stimulating photosynthesis, enhancing plant immunity and increasing nutritional value."
Samsung said the new solutions also help farmers spot plant diseases through bright white lighting.
Along with the full-spectrum white LEDs, Samsung also introduced blue, deep-red and far-red LEDs to meet different demands from horticulture lighting manufacturers.
"Built on Samsung's market-proven LED technologies, the new full spectrum and color LED lineups feature a high degree of reliability, making them well-suited to withstand high temperatures and humidity levels, as well as agricultural chemicals used in greenhouses and vertical farming," the company added.
Samsung said it will start supplying the new products this month to clients.
